Output 88e77e2955528c0a9f972439d4007c37b376400afc911ba3e0fddad61e66cd5a:52

value
864494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b11486ed3d5158110a2400f59f8e0ab4a2b79802 OP_EQUAL
address
3HqL7k2gaTfXr9D2eLZr17LZgye4uQbPbM
transaction
88e77e2955528c0a9f972439d4007c37b376400afc911ba3e0fddad61e66cd5a
spent
true